Applications and System Architecture
This pressure switch is predominantly found in hydraulic power units, automated leakage testers, and pneumatic safety systems. In a typical architecture, the 41.100.10 provides the «System Ready» signal to the controller, ensuring that pneumatic actuators have sufficient pressure to operate safely. It is also widely used in pump control logic to prevent dry running or over-pressurization. Its robust mechanical interface allows it to handle high-frequency cycling in high-throughput sorting machines and precision pick-and-place robots. By integrating the 41.100.10, engineers can implement fail-safe loops that protect expensive downstream machinery from pressure-related failures.
Maintenance Tips
To ensure the continued accuracy of the 41.100.10, we recommend an annual calibration check against a certified master gauge. Over time, moisture in air lines can cause particulate buildup in the pressure port; ensure that an upstream 5-micron filter is installed to keep the internal diaphragm clean. If the switch is used in high-vibration applications, periodically check the electrical terminal tightness to prevent intermittent signal loss. For systems involving significant pressure spikes, consider adding a capillary snubber to the inlet to protect the internal sensing element from fatigue-induced failure.
